The utility model discloses an automatic entry and exit system for articles based on RFID technology, which comprises a controller, an article entry and storage area, an article exit and storage area, a first RFID tag arranged beside the article entry and exit area, and an article The second RFID tag next to the outbound storage area, the item storage device, the mechanical transmission input device arranged between the item storage area and the item storage device, the mechanical transmission set between the item outbound storage area and the item storage device output devices, and objects. The beneficial effect of the utility model is: the staff controls the operation of the whole system by operating the controller, wherein the controller is wirelessly connected to the RFID tag, and establishes a corresponding relationship between the RFID tag and the goods or the goods storage and transportation process, and through the RFID Labels are used to feedback the inbound and outbound of goods and inventory management, realize the convenience and automation of warehouse logistics management, reduce labor input, reduce errors, and improve management efficiency and data accuracy.

如图1-3所示,提供一种基于RFID技术的物品自动出入库系统,包括控制器1,物品入库放置区21,物品出库放置区22,设置在物品入库放置区21旁的第一RFID标签31,设置在物品出库放置区22旁的第二RFID标签32,物品储存装置5,设置在物品入库放置区21与物品储存装置5之间的机械传动输入装置41,设置在物品出库放置区22与物品储存装置5之间的机械传动输出装置42,以及物品6,物品6上设置有自动驱动装置61,逻辑控制系统62和地址器63(见图2)。As shown in Figure 1-3, provide a kind of article automatic entry and exit system based on RFID technology, comprise controller 1, article entry placement area 21, article exit placement area 22, be arranged next to article entry placement area 21 The first RFID tag 31, the second RFID tag 32 arranged on the side of the item storage area 22, the item storage device 5, the mechanical transmission input device 41 arranged between the item storage area 21 and the item storage device 5, set The mechanical transmission output device 42 between the article outbound placement area 22 and the article storage device 5, and the article 6 are provided with an automatic drive device 61, a logic control system 62 and an address device 63 (see FIG. 2).
物品储存装置5用于储存物品6,其内设置有多个RFID标签,控制器1通过无线网路控制第一RFID标签31、第二RFID标签32、物品储存装置5内的多个RFID标签 以及机械传动输入装置41和机械传动输出装置42;机械传动输入装置41和机械传动输出装置42都用于物品的输送,其都包括输送轨道431,输送轨道431在水平与垂直方向处设置有转接台432,转接台432处设置有读址器433(见图3)。Article storage device 5 is used for storing article 6, and a plurality of RFID tags are arranged in it, and controller 1 controls first RFID tag 31, the second RFID tag 32, a plurality of RFID tags in article storage device 5 and The mechanical transmission input device 41 and the mechanical transmission output device 42; the mechanical transmission input device 41 and the mechanical transmission output device 42 are all used for the conveying of the article, and it all includes a conveying track 431, and the conveying track 431 is provided with a transfer in the horizontal and vertical directions. Station 432, and an address reader 433 (see FIG. 3 ) is arranged at the switching station 432.
本发明的一种基于RFID技术的物品自动出入库系统是按照以下方式进行工作的:A kind of article automatic entry and exit system based on RFID technology of the present invention works in the following manner:
入库:当物品6设置在物品入库放置区21,第一RFID标签31自动读取物品6信息,并将该信息通过无线网路反馈至控制器1,控制器1根据原始设置好的程序自动判别物品6应放置的位置处,然后控制机械传动输入装置41将物品6传送至指定位置,物品6上设置有自动驱动装置61,逻辑控制系统62和地址器63,用于将物品6运输至指定的地点,在运输的过程中,通过转接台432将水平运输转为垂直运输,实现物品6在空间内的任意方向运输。Storage: When the item 6 is placed in the item storage area 21, the first RFID tag 31 automatically reads the information of the item 6, and feeds the information back to the controller 1 through the wireless network, and the controller 1 according to the originally set program Automatically judge the position where the item 6 should be placed, and then control the mechanical transmission input device 41 to transfer the item 6 to the designated position. The item 6 is provided with an automatic drive device 61, a logic control system 62 and an address device 63 for transporting the item 6 To the designated place, during the transportation process, the horizontal transportation is converted to vertical transportation through the transfer table 432, so as to realize the transportation of the item 6 in any direction in the space.
盘库:当物品6储存在物品储存装置5上时,其内设置的多个RFID标签自动读取物品6的信息,并将该信息通过无线网路传送至控制器1处,工作人员可以直接通过控制器查询库存量,物品库存位置等库存信息。Disk library: when the item 6 is stored on the item storage device 5, the multiple RFID tags set in it automatically read the information of the item 6, and transmit the information to the controller 1 through the wireless network, and the staff can directly Query inventory information such as inventory quantity and item inventory location through the controller.
出库:当工作人员需要取货时,通过操作控制器1使其发送指令,该指令通过无线网路传送至物品储存装置5内的各个RFID标签,RFID标签阅读器修改读取该物品上的RFID标签,并将该信息通过无线网路传送至控制器1,控制器1控制机械传送输出装置42将指定物品6传送至物品出库放置区22。Out of the warehouse: When the staff needs to pick up the goods, they send instructions by operating the controller 1, and the instructions are sent to each RFID tag in the article storage device 5 through the wireless network, and the RFID tag reader modifies and reads the tags on the article. RFID tag, and transmit the information to the controller 1 through the wireless network, and the controller 1 controls the mechanical transmission output device 42 to transmit the specified item 6 to the item delivery area 22 .
